Pardus Linux Security Advisory 2009-91            security@pardus.org.tr
------------------------------------------------------------------------

      Date: 2009-06-24
  Severity: 3
      Type: Remote
------------------------------------------------------------------------

Summary
======
A vulnerability has been discovered in GStreamer Good  Plug-ins,  which

can be exploited by  malicious  people  to  potentially  compromise  an
application using the library.


Description
==========
The vulnerability is  caused  due  to  an  integer  overflow  error  in

ext/libpng/gstpngdec.c, which can be exploited to  cause  a  heap-based
buffer overflow via a specially crafted PNG file.



Successful exploitation may allow execution of arbitrary code.




Affected packages:

  Pardus 2008:
    gst-plugins-good, all before 0.10.11-16-9


Resolution
=========
There are update(s) for  gst-plugins-good.  You  can  update  them  via
Package Manager or with a single command from console:

    pisi up gst-plugins-good
